1. What is Percocet and Its Status in Italy?
Percocet is a brand-name prescription painkiller that combines two active ingredients: oxycodone (a potent opioid agonist) and acetaminophen (paracetamol). It is mostly recommended for the short-term management of moderate to reasonably severe intense pain.
Nevertheless, global tourists typically come across a major roadblock right away: trademark name do not generally cross borders.
In addition, because oxycodone is an effective opioid with a high capacity for reliance and abuse, it is classified as a strictly managed substance in Italy. You can not simply walk into a pharmacy and purchase it over-the-counter.
2. Italian Pharmaceutical Regulations at a Glance
Italy runs under a rigorous public-private healthcare design supervised by the Ministry of Health (Ministero della Salute). The Italian pharmaceutical system is divided into different classes of medications, with strict protocols governing narcotics.
Medication ClassificationDescriptionAvailability in ItalySopra il banco (OTC)Over-the-counter drugs; no prescription required.Pain reducers like ibuprofen and paracetamol.Sotto Acquistare Farmaci Con Prescrizione Medica In Italia (Rx)Standard prescription drugs for typical conditions.Antibiotics, standard high blood pressure medications.Medicinali StupefacentiStrictly controlled narcotics and psychotropic compounds.Strong opioids, consisting of oxycodone.
To obtain any medication classified under Stupefacenti (Narcotics), people must comply with the strict laws dictated by Italian DPR 309/90 (the Consolidated Law on Narcotic Drugs).

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Can I purchase Percocet over the counter in Italy?
No. Percocet, and any medication containing oxycodone, is a strictly managed narcotic Antidolorifici In Italia Italy. It is totally illegal to acquire it without a valid prescription issued by a certified physician licensed to prescribe controlled compounds in Italy.
Will an Italian pharmacy accept my U.S. or foreign prescription?
Normally, no. Italian pharmacists can not lawfully give illegal drugs based on foreign prescriptions. You will need to see an Italian doctor to have a regional prescription written.
What is the Italian equivalent of Percocet?
While the trademark name "Percocet" does not exist in Italy, doctors can recommend generic combinations of oxycodone and paracetamol (acetaminophen) or standalone oxycodone items, provided they satisfy diagnostic requirements.
What should I do if I lack my medication while taking a trip in Italy?
Do not try to buy medication through unregulated online suppliers or street sources, as counterfeit drugs including lethal artificial opioids (like fentanyl) are a massive worldwide threat. Instead, check out the nearest health center emergency room (Pronto Soccorso) or call a local traveler medical service (Guardia Medica) to explain your situation, show your empty medication bottle, and present your home nation's medical documentation.
Are there restrictions on the amount of opioids I can bring into Italy?
Yes. Travelers getting in Italy bring personal medications including controlled substances need to typically restrict their supply to what is reasonably needed for their trip (generally no greater than 30 days) and carry a medical certificate or prescription copy to present to customizeds authorities if asked for.
